Understanding the Mechanics and the Appeal

The basic gameplay of the “aviator” style game is remarkably straightforward. Players place a bet before each round, and then watch as a virtual airplane begins its ascent. The long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ier climbs. The player’s goal is to cash out before the plane disappears from the screen. If they cash out in time, they receive their initial bet multiplied by the current multiplier. However, if the plane flies away before they cash out, they lose their stake. The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)

It's essential to understand that the flight path of the plane is governed by a Random Number Generator (RNG). This ensures that each round is independent and unbiased. The RNG doesn't “remember” previous results, and it doesn't favor any particular strategy. While you can analyze past data and look for patterns, it's crucial to recognize that these patterns are likely due to chance and are not indicative of future outcomes. Relying solely on past results to predict future flights is a common mistake amongst novice players.

The RNG works by generating a random number that determines when the plane will fly away. This number is kept secret, ensuring fairness and transparency. Reputable online casinos regularly audit their RNGs to verify their integrity. Understanding this fundamental aspect of the game is important for managing expectations and avoiding the gambler’s fallacy – the belief that past events influence future independent events.

Managing Tilt and Emotional Control

“Tilt” is a term commonly used in gambling to describe a state of emotional frustration and irrational decision-making. It typically occurs after experiencing a series of losses, leading players to deviate from their established strategy and chase their losses. Managing tilt is crucial for protecting your bankroll and maintaining a rational approach. If you find yourself becoming frustrated or emotional, take a break from the game. Step away, clear your head, and reassess your strategy before resuming play.
